Transaction 107e508b1ba2830c76b885f6961b82306439958e1a2ff1356a0d8b775568a178
1 Input
1 Output
-
107e508b1ba2830c76b885f6961b82306439958e1a2ff1356a0d8b775568a178:0
- value
- 2042884
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e8831f2e6833a5273b6b895030360689dc4b62d OP_EQUALVERIFY OP_CHECKSIG
- address
- 12KqcguFvM9dHG8UQibvPRbfZhtNbpMD97